Action Potential
A temporary shift in the electrical charge of a neuron's membrane, leading to the transmission of a nerve impulse.
Electrical Signal
The transmission of information through neurons or other cells using changes in voltage or electric current.
Axon
The long, slender projection of a neuron that conducts electrical impulses away from the neuron's cell body towards other neurons or muscles.
Myelin Sheath
A layer of fatty tissue surrounding the axons of some neurons that speeds up the transmission of electrical impulses.
